Pune: Higher education institutions have been directed to submit details of measures taken to prevent the entry of stray dogs onto campuses and to ensure the safety of students, faculty, and staff by July 10.

{{^htLoading}} {{/htLoading}}
The directive comes in the wake of a Supreme Court order issued in November 2025 concerning the impact of stray dog incidents on children in urban areas.
The compliance report, to be submitted online, should include information on measures such as restricting stray dog movement within campus premises, installing fencing or access-control systems, and implementing safety protocols for students, teachers, and employees.
